本文目錄導(dǎo)讀:
CSS中的圖層管理與優(yōu)化策略
在網(wǎng)頁設(shè)計中,CSS(層疊樣式表)扮演著***關(guān)重要的角色,它負責(zé)定義網(wǎng)頁的外觀和布局,在復(fù)雜的網(wǎng)頁設(shè)計中,我們經(jīng)常需要處理多個圖層,以確保它們能夠和諧地共存并呈現(xiàn)出預(yù)期的效果,本文將探討在CSS中如何有效地管理和優(yōu)化圖層。
理解CSS圖層概念
在CSS中,圖層可以理解為具有特定樣式和屬性的HTML元素的集合,每個元素都可以看作是一個獨立的圖層,通過CSS我們可以控制這些圖層的屬性,如位置、大小、顏色等,理解圖層概念是進行有效網(wǎng)頁設(shè)計的基礎(chǔ)。
使用定位屬性控制圖層
在CSS中,我們可以使用定位屬性(如position、top、left、right、bottom等)來***控制圖層的位置,通過調(diào)整這些屬性,我們可以將不同的元素放置在頁面的不同位置,從而創(chuàng)建出豐富的視覺效果。
利用CSS框架和組件優(yōu)化圖層管理
在現(xiàn)代網(wǎng)頁設(shè)計中,許多***會選擇使用CSS框架(如Bootstrap、Foundation等)和組件來簡化圖層管理,這些工具和框架提供了預(yù)定義的樣式和組件,使我們能夠更快速地構(gòu)建復(fù)雜的網(wǎng)頁結(jié)構(gòu),并有效地管理圖層。
優(yōu)化圖層加載和性能
隨著網(wǎng)頁中圖層數(shù)量的增加,頁面的加載速度和性能可能會受到影響,我們需要關(guān)注圖層的加載和優(yōu)化,這包括壓縮CSS代碼、使用雪碧圖技術(shù)減少HTTP請求、優(yōu)化圖片格式和大小等。
保持圖層結(jié)構(gòu)的清晰和可維護性
為了保持圖層結(jié)構(gòu)的清晰和可維護性,我們需要遵循良好的編碼規(guī)范和實踐,這包括使用有意義的類名和ID、編寫清晰的注釋、遵循響應(yīng)式設(shè)計原則等。
在CSS中管理和優(yōu)化圖層是構(gòu)建***網(wǎng)頁的關(guān)鍵之一,通過理解圖層概念、使用定位屬性、利用CSS框架和組件、優(yōu)化圖層加載和性能以及保持圖層結(jié)構(gòu)的清晰和可維護性,我們可以創(chuàng)建出既美觀又高效的網(wǎng)頁。